修复 EvalStackCalculator计算泛型类字段类型未inflate的bug
parent
38ebe11d7d
commit
2572841e59
|
@ -728,7 +728,7 @@ namespace Obfuz.Emit
|
||||||
{
|
{
|
||||||
IField field = (IField)inst.Operand;
|
IField field = (IField)inst.Operand;
|
||||||
TypeSig fieldType = MetaUtil.InflateFieldSig(field, gac);
|
TypeSig fieldType = MetaUtil.InflateFieldSig(field, gac);
|
||||||
PushStack(newPushedDatas, field.FieldSig.GetFieldType());
|
PushStack(newPushedDatas, fieldType);
|
||||||
break;
|
break;
|
||||||
}
|
}
|
||||||
case Code.Ldflda:
|
case Code.Ldflda:
|
||||||
|
|
Loading…
Reference in New Issue